在数字阅读日益普及的今天,许多读者对《间谍的战争》这类优质小说的TXT版本下载需求显著增加。在实际操作中,用户常遇到下载失败、文件损坏、资源失效等问题。本文将从技术角度全面分析《间谍的战争》TXT下载的常见问题,并提供多种解决方案,涵盖资源获取、下载技巧及工具推荐,帮助读者高效完成下载任务。
一、常见下载问题及原因分析
1. 资源链接失效
由于版权保护或服务器维护,部分网站提供的下载链接可能失效。例如,用户反馈的54和57中提到的官方下载页面可能出现访问限制,导致无法直接获取文件。
2. 文件完整性不足
部分TXT文件在下载过程中因网络波动或服务器中断导致内容缺失,尤其是大文件(如超过1MB的完整版小说)更易出现此类问题。
3. 格式兼容性问题
下载的TXT文件可能因编码格式不兼容(如UTF-8与ANSI编码冲突)导致乱码,常见于跨平台设备(手机、电脑、电子书阅读器)之间的文件传输。
4. 恶意软件捆绑
非正规渠道下载的TXT文件可能携带广告插件或病毒,威胁设备安全。
二、综合解决方案
方案1:选择可靠资源平台
访问小说官网(如54提及的),通过“电子书下载”入口获取正版资源。若页面失效,可尝试切换浏览器或清除缓存后重新访问。
通过GitHub等平台搜索《间谍的战争》TXT文件。例如,64中的开源电子书库(kska32/ebooks)收录了近10万本电子书,用户可通过关键词检索获取资源。
方案2:优化下载工具与技巧
使用支持断点续传的下载工具(如IDM、Free Download Manager),避免因网络中断导致重复下载。以IDM为例:
1. 安装后右键点击下载链接,选择“使用IDM下载”。
2. 在设置中开启“自动捕获下载链接”功能,提升抓取效率。
对于分章节下载的TXT文件(如57列出的1456章),可使用JDownloader等工具批量添加任务,并设置并发线程数为5-10以加速下载。
方案3:文件修复与校验
若出现乱码,使用Notepad++或Sublime Text打开文件,选择“编码→转换为UTF-8”保存。
通过HashCheck等工具生成文件的MD5或SHA-1校验码,与官方提供的哈希值对比,确保文件未被篡改。
方案4:替代格式获取
若仅能找到PDF或EPUB版本(如74中的技术文档),可使用Calibre电子书管理软件进行格式转换:
1. 导入文件后选择“转换书籍→TXT输出”。
2. 调整段落分隔符和编码设置以避免格式错乱。
三、推荐工具清单
| 工具名称 | 功能特性 | 适用场景 |
| Internet Download Manager (IDM) | 支持多线程下载、断点续传、自动捕获链接 | 大文件高速下载 |
| Free Download Manager | 开源免费,兼容Torrent协议 | 多资源并行下载 |
| Calibre | 电子书格式转换、元数据编辑 | EPUB/PDF转TXT |
| HashCheck | 文件完整性校验,支持MD5/SHA-1比对 | 验证TXT文件安全性 |
| JDownloader | 批量下载、自动解压、密码管理 | 分章节小说合集下载 |
四、高级技巧与注意事项
1. 规避版权风险
优先选择标注“公共领域”或“创作共享协议”的资源,避免从盗版网站下载。例如,57提到的TXT全集若标注“人气259.22万”,需警惕非授权版本。
2. 自动化脚本辅助
技术用户可编写Python脚本(基于Requests库)定期爬取更新章节,并自动合并为完整TXT文件,示例代码框架如下:
python
import requests
from bs4 import BeautifulSoup
模拟浏览器访问章节页面
headers = {'User-Agent': 'Mozilla/5.0'}
response = requests.get(" headers=headers)
soup = BeautifulSoup(response.text, 'html.parser')
提取章节链接并批量下载
chapters = soup.select('.chapter-list a')
with open('spy_war.txt', 'w', encoding='utf-8') as f:
for chap in chapters:
content = requests.get(chap['href']).text
f.write(content + '
')
3. 云端同步备份
将下载的TXT文件存储至阿里云OSS、Google Drive等平台,通过12所示的API实现跨设备访问与版本控制。
通过上述方法,读者可系统性解决《间谍的战争》TXT下载中的技术障碍。建议优先使用正版资源,结合高效工具与科学管理策略,既能保障阅读体验,也能有效维护数字版权生态。